In the Doraemon franchise, Shizuka Minamoto ’s bathing scenes are a recurring trope and running gag, appearing in numerous manga chapters, television episodes, and feature films. These scenes often occur when Nobita accidentally enters her bathroom via a gadget, such as the "Anywhere Door," leading to Shizuka’s signature scream and water-splashing response. In response to the decades of controversy and the 2020 petition, the depiction of Shizuka in the bath has evolved significantly. The blunt nudity and "butt shots" that were a staple of the 1979 anime have been replaced by more sanitized and controlled imagery. The heavy censorship methods such as impenetrable steam, silhouettes, and towels have become the new norm. However, the debate is far from settled. The 2020 petition garnered thousands of signatures, but not enough to force a change in production on its own. It did, however, succeed in shifting the Overton window regarding what is acceptable in children's anime.
